  • kyfdxkyfdx Moderator Posts: 268,141
    thockey13 said:

    Michaell said:

    thockey13 said:



    LTD - 59% and .00015
    TOUR - 60% and .00035

    No information on the "50th anniversary" trim.

    Thanks Michael! What is the max Money factor markup for the Touring? I'm trying to figure out how they came to their numbers, definitely some added fees and probably marking that up.

    Their "Math"
    MSRP: 35,549
    Dealer Discount: 2,542
    Vehicle Price: 33006.40
    Residual: 21329.40

    + Accessories (glass etching I think): 299
    -Trade 3750
    -No down payment
    Trade difference price: 29,555.40


    Their "Purchase tax and fees"
    Lisc/Title: 300.55
    Tire/Battery/VTR: 5.00
    Sales/Use Tax: 2068.88
    Total Taxes and Fees: 2,374.43
    Total: 31,929.83

    Monthly Payment: "$349-$364"

    I come in around $289 a month after taxes in my math below.





    The rate can be marked up by .00050.

    In your example, you didn't account for the $594.90 due at signing. You have to subtract that from the $3750 rebate, before applying the rest as CAP reduction.
    Also, the rebate will be taxed, so subtract 10% sales tax, before applying the rest.

  • kyfdxkyfdx Moderator Posts: 268,141

    kyfdx said:



    Florida is a crappy place to buy a car. California is the most competitive market in the country. I definitely would wait.

    Taxes won't matter, as both states tax the monthly payment.

    Intersting, why is Florida a crappy place to buy? I looked at some other dealers in LA where I'd be moving and they seem to have the same monthly payment promo but require a $2000 down payment.

    Massive dealer fees.. hidden/extra charges for electronic filing.. crappy packages.
    California restricts dealer fees to $80.. $599 and up for Florida dealers is the going rate.
